This recipe for quick and easy no-bake chocolate peanut butter cookies is a lifesaver for busy days when you need a sweet treat without turning on the oven. Combining rich cocoa, creamy peanut butter, and chewy oats, these cookies come together on the stovetop in just a few minutes. They set into a fudgy, satisfying treat that perfectly balances sweet and salty. Ideal for an emergency dessert, a fast after-school snack, or a simple solution when the oven is occupied.
Table of Contents
Why You’ll Love no-bake chocolate peanut butter cookies
These no-bake cookies are a classic for a reason—they are incredibly fast, simple, and consistently delicious. The magic happens in one pot, making cleanup a breeze.
- Quick & Easy: Ready from start to finish in under 20 minutes, with most of that time spent waiting for them to set.
- No Oven Required: The perfect recipe for hot summer days or when you don’t want to heat up the kitchen.
- Simple Ingredients: Made with common pantry staples you likely already have on hand.
- Unbelievably Delicious: A fudgy, chewy texture with the irresistible flavor combination of chocolate and peanut butter.
- Perfect for Beginners: A foolproof recipe that is great for getting kids involved in the kitchen.
Ingredients For no-bake chocolate peanut butter cookies

- 2 cups granulated sugar
- ½ cup milk (any kind works, including dairy-free)
- ½ cup (1 stick) unsalted butter, cut into pieces
- ¼ cup unsweetened cocoa powder
- Pinch of salt
- 1 cup creamy peanut butter
- 2 teaspoons vanilla extract
- 3 cups old-fashioned or quick-cooking oats
How to Make no-bake chocolate peanut butter cookies

- Prep Your Station: Before you start, lay out two large sheets of parchment paper or wax paper on your counter. This is where you’ll drop the cookies to set, and things move quickly once you start cooking.
- Combine Core Ingredients: In a medium-sized saucepan, combine the granulated sugar, milk, butter, cocoa powder, and salt.
- Bring to a Boil: Place the saucepan over medium heat. Stir constantly as the butter melts and the sugar dissolves. Bring the mixture to a full, rolling boil.
- The Critical Minute: Once the mixture reaches a rolling boil, stop stirring and let it boil for exactly 60 seconds. This step is crucial. Boiling for too long will result in dry, crumbly cookies; not boiling long enough will prevent them from setting properly. Set a timer!
- Remove from Heat & Add Flavor: Immediately remove the saucepan from the heat. Stir in the peanut butter and vanilla extract until the peanut butter is completely melted and the mixture is smooth.
- Add the Oats: Quickly stir in the oats until they are evenly coated with the chocolate-peanut butter mixture.
- Drop and Set: Working quickly, drop heaping tablespoons of the mixture onto your prepared parchment paper. Let the cookies sit at room temperature for at least 30 minutes, or until they are firm and completely set. To speed up the process, you can place them in the refrigerator.
Serving and Storage Tips
- Serving: These cookies are ready to eat as soon as they are set. They are a wonderful snack with a glass of milk or a cup of coffee.
- Storage: Store the cookies in a single layer in an airtight container at room temperature for up to a week. If stacking, place a sheet of parchment paper between the layers to prevent sticking.
Helpful Notes
- The 60-Second Rule: The boiling time is the most important step. Use a timer to ensure accuracy for the perfect fudgy texture.
- Oat Type: Both quick-cooking and old-fashioned rolled oats work well in this recipe. Rolled oats will give a chewier, more distinct texture, while quick oats yield a softer, more uniform cookie.
- Weather Watch: Humidity can affect how no-bake cookies set. On very humid or rainy days, they may take longer to firm up or remain slightly tacky.
Conclusion

This quick and easy no-bake chocolate peanut butter cookie recipe is the ultimate go-to for instant gratification. With its minimal effort and maximum flavor payoff, it’s a treasured recipe for any home baker. The rich, fudgy texture and classic flavor pairing make it an irresistible treat for all ages. If you made these no-bake wonders, please let us know how they turned out by leaving a comment and a star rating below! We love seeing your creations, so be sure to share a photo on Facebook or Pinterest.
More Recipes to Explore
Classic Chocolate Chip Cookies
Soft centers, golden edges, and timeless flavor make these the perfect lunchbox treat or after-school snack kids and adults adore.
Peanut Butter Lunchbox Cookies
Rich and chewy with a protein boost from peanut butter, these cookies stay fresh for days — hearty, satisfying, and perfect for on-the-go.
Oatmeal Kitchen Sink Cookies
Packed with oats, fruit, chocolate, and surprise mix-ins, these cookies balance wholesome goodness with irresistible sweetness.
Soft Sugar Cookies with School-Themed Designs
Fun to shape and decorate, these soft sugar cookies double as a creative project — ideal for gifting to teachers or first-day celebrations.

Quick & Easy No-Bake Cookies

Ingredients
- 2 cups granulated sugar
- ½ cup milk any kind works, including dairy-free
- ½ cup 1 stick unsalted butter, cut into pieces
- ¼ cup unsweetened cocoa powder
- Pinch of salt
- 1 cup creamy peanut butter
- 2 teaspoons vanilla extract
- 3 cups old-fashioned or quick-cooking oats
Instructions
Prep Your Station:
- Before you start, lay out two large sheets of parchment paper or wax paper on your counter. This is where you’ll drop the cookies to set, and things move quickly once you start cooking.
Combine Core Ingredients:
- In a medium-sized saucepan, combine the granulated sugar, milk, butter, cocoa powder, and salt.
Bring to a Boil:
- Place the saucepan over medium heat. Stir constantly as the butter melts and the sugar dissolves. Bring the mixture to a full, rolling boil.
The Critical Minute:
- Once the mixture reaches a rolling boil, stop stirring and let it boil for exactly 60 seconds. This step is crucial. Boiling for too long will result in dry, crumbly cookies; not boiling long enough will prevent them from setting properly. Set a timer!
Remove from Heat & Add Flavor:
- Immediately remove the saucepan from the heat. Stir in the peanut butter and vanilla extract until the peanut butter is completely melted and the mixture is smooth.
Add the Oats:
- Quickly stir in the oats until they are evenly coated with the chocolate-peanut butter mixture.
Drop and Set:
- Working quickly, drop heaping tablespoons of the mixture onto your prepared parchment paper. Let the cookies sit at room temperature for at least 30 minutes, or until they are firm and completely set. To speed up the process, you can place them in the refrigerator.
Notes
Nutrition Information (per serving)
- Calories: 155 kcal
- Fat: 7g
- Saturated Fat: 4g
- Carbohydrates: 22g
- Sugar: 16g
- Protein: 3g
- Fiber: 1.5g
-
Sodium: 85mg
(Disclaimer: Nutrition information is an estimate and may vary based on ingredients and preparation.)
Frequently Asked Questions (FAQ)
Can I use an alternative ingredient?
Yes, you can use crunchy peanut butter for more texture or substitute other nut/seed butters like almond butter or Sunbutter. You can also use a dairy-free milk and butter alternative to make them vegan.
How do I make this gluten-free?
This recipe is easily made gluten-free. Just ensure you are using certified gluten-free oats. All other ingredients are typically gluten-free, but it’s always wise to check the labels.
Why did my cookies not set?
The most common reason for no-bake cookies not setting is that the sugar mixture was not boiled for the full 60 seconds. Reaching the right temperature is what allows the sugar to set up properly once it cools.
Is this recipe freezer-friendly?
Yes! Once the cookies are fully set, you can freeze them in a freezer-safe container or bag, with parchment paper between layers, for up to 3 months. Let them thaw at room temperature for a few minutes before enjoying.
How thick should the consistency be?
After adding the oats, the mixture will be thick but still easy to scoop and drop. It should look glossy and wet. It will firm up as it cools on the parchment paper.